
Fig. 9. Ultra thin cryosections showing subcellular localisation of TbCLH. (A)
Conventional Epon section showing clathrin-like coats on a vesicle
(arrowheads) and a tubular profile (arrows). (B-D) Cryosections labelled with
TbCLH followed by 6 nm protein A gold show clathrin in association with a
tubular profile (B); on membranes and vesicles in a region between the Golgi
and the flagellar pocket (C); and also TbCLH labelling of membranes and
vesicles just below the plasma membrane (D). In C, the 6 nm gold particles
originally used for increased resolution have been digitally enhanced using
Adobe Illustrator by placing black circles corresponding to
15nm
diameter over the Gold particles. Bars, 100 nm, the position of the Golgi
complex, endoplasmic reticulum (ER) and plasma membrane (PM) are
indicated.
